Calvert County Awarded Site Characterization Grant for Patuxent Business Park


Calvert County announced that is has been awarded a Site Characterization Grant through the Maryland Business Ready Sites Program (MBRSP) to support the continued development of Patuxent Business Park.

This study, funded by a $10,000 state grant matched by the Economic Development Authority funds, will:

  • Evaluate the development status of available lots in the park. 
  • Determine what types of businesses the site can support. 
  • Assign a “site readiness” score (Tier 1–5) to help attract private investment.

Created by Governor Wes Moore in December 2024, MBRSP accelerates investment across Maryland by increasing the number of shovel-ready sites. The program is administered by Maryland Economic Development Corporation (MEDCO) in close collaboration with local and state economic development agencies and provides both financial assistance and marketing support.

This award highlights Calvert County’s proactive approach to economic development and its commitment to preparing for the industries and jobs of tomorrow.
